The attack surface here is massive: 22 universities, 450,000-plus students, and 56,000 faculty and staff spread across California. California State University isn't just a single network - it's a distributed system of interconnected campuses, each with its own infrastructure, endpoints, and data flows. The threat model spans student data protection, research integrity, and operational continuity across a public institution that handles everything from financial aid records to healthcare information.
Founded in 1960, Cal State operates as the nation's largest four-year public university system. The security challenge scales accordingly: identity and access management across hundreds of thousands of users, endpoint hardening on a budget that isn't venture-backed, and defending against phishing campaigns that target a constantly rotating population of students and staff. The system emphasizes collaboration across campuses, which means security teams aren't siloed - they're coordinating policy, tooling, and incident response across institutional boundaries.
The work runs deep into domains like network segmentation for campus environments, cloud security posture management for increasingly SaaS-dependent operations, and compliance frameworks tied to FERPA, HIPAA (where applicable), and state-level data protection mandates.
